WebAug 28, 2024 · Generally, yes. Hundreds of companies provide employment background checks and qualify as consumer reporting agencies. Employment reports often include credit checks, criminal background checks, public records – such as bankruptcy filings and other court documents – and information related to your employment history. WebCredit discrimination is often hidden or even unintentional, which makes it hard to spot. Look for red flags, such as: Treated differently in person than on the phone or online; Discouraged from applying for credit; Encouraged or told to apply for a type of loan that has less favorable terms (for example, a higher interest rate)
